Acupuncture is the placement of disposable, hair-thin needles into specific points along energy channels on the body. Qi flows within these meridians or pathways. Stimulating qi flow balances a person to relieve symptoms and eliminate an illness. [top]

Electrical Acupuncture is the attachment of an electrical current to certain points of the body to generate a slight pulsation through the needle into the muscle and meridian pathway. This eases tense muscles and moves qi and blood in a contained area or within a meridian to reduce pain. Electrical acupuncture is also used in facelifts to expand the collagen in your face, reduce wrinkles and lift the skin. [top]

Chinese Herbal Medicine combines a variety of herbs to create a unique formula for each patient. A customized herbal prescription is administered based on the individual’s symptoms and constitution. Chinese herbal medicine’s goal is to treat the source of a problem and eradicate it. [top]

Cupping is the placement of glass or plastic cups on the skin to create a suction, which then helps to free toxins and move qi and blood. Cupping is an excellent way to treat muscle tightness, arthritis or pain, fevers, colds and flu, asthma, and lung weakness. [top]

Moxibustion is burning of the herb ai ye (mugwort) on needles or over specific points of the body. This process facilitates qi and blood movement and warms channels and the body. Moxibustion is highly beneficial for those with fatigue, digestive disorders, and injuries. The Chinese people use moxa daily to stay healthy, active and ensure longevity. [top]

Gua Sha: A porcelain spoon along with a special liniment is used to ‘massage’ specific points on the body to release toxins, reduce muscle aches, and relieve pent up emotions. [top]

Lymphatic Drainage: A gentle, rhythmic massage to stimulate your lymph to circulate and remove toxins and wastes from the body. This massage reduces water retention and the appearance of cellulite.
